The recap of Episode 2 of "A Good Girl's Guide To Murder" kicks off with Pip delving into a poignant interview with Emma Hutton, Andie's cherished confidante. As Emma responds to Pip's inquiries about Andie and Sal's bond, her answers resonate with a bland uniformity, masking any underlying complexities. Pip inquires about potential rifts in their relationship, only to be met with Emma's assurance that Andie and Sal's union was unmarred by conflict. However, a mention of Andie's texted spat with Ravi stirs a visceral reaction within Emma, who emphatically asserts her familiarity with her late friend and implores Pip to sever all future contact.

Later in the day, as Pip retreats to the solitude of her chamber, an unexpected visitor in the form of Leanne disrupts her thoughts. Leanne's plea is heartfelt: to spare the Bell family, still reeling from the tragic loss of their daughter, from further intrusion through interviews. Amidst this emotional exchange, Pip also confides in her mother about her aspirations for higher education, browsing through potential universities for post-graduation.

A text from Ravi interrupts her reverie, prompting a rendezvous. Over their meeting, Pip unburdens herself about the failed interview with Emma, segueing into discussions of Andie's other closest companion, Nat Da Silva. Ravi's revelation that Nat had been thrust into the limelight for all the wrong reasons—her nude photo scandal months prior to Andie's disappearance—casts a new light on the situation.

As evening descends, Pip makes amends with Cara by seeking forgiveness for inadvertently dragging Naomi into their conversation. Cara shares the emotional toll Naomi has endured since their mother's passing, which has been exacerbated by the loss of her dearest friend, Sal. Pip vows to shield Naomi from her investigative endeavors while inquiring about Nat's controversial photograph. Naomi's overheard warning echoes through the room, cautioning Pip against tangling with Nat.

Amidst the tension, Cara reveals their impending tennis rivalry, set to unfold later in the week. The evening draws to a close with Elliot's arrival home from tutoring sessions.

Days later, Pip and her circle of friends find themselves amidst the charged atmosphere of Naomi's tennis match against Nat. The defeat leaves Nat seething, retreating to the dressing room in a fit of anger. Pip, driven by a sense of purpose, trails after Nat, seeking to delve into the intricacies of Andie's life and her connection with Sal. The stage is set for a confrontation that may unravel hidden truths.

Nat unveils a bombshell, hinting that Andie had embarked on intimate liaisons with a fresh face, yet she refrains from divulging any specifics, leaving Pip intrigued beyond measure. Urging Pip to desist from probing further into the matter, Nat's words only fan the flames of curiosity within her. As the day winds down, Dan, Nat's elder sibling, collects Pip post-game, and Pip's eyes widen in recognition—he's the same individual who, at the Hastings' soirée, had urged her to abandon her investigation. Pip brushes him off with a dismissive glance, steadfastly making her way home.

That very evening, Pip prepares for a woodland escapade with her comrades—Lauren, Cara, Zach, and Connor—a picnic amidst nature's embrace. Prior to their rendezvous, Pip crosses paths with Ravi, sharing with her the cryptic conversation she had with Nat. Together, they concoct a mischievous plan, impersonating Nat via text to pry into Emma's knowledge about Andie's romantic entanglements. Emma's whispers of a mysterious older suitor only deepen the mystery, piquing Pip and Ravi's curiosity to new heights.

As Pip's friends gather, they observe her bidding farewell to Ravi before embarking on their adventure. The evening unfolds with laughter and splashes in the serene lake, their camaraderie culminating in a cozy campsite amidst the forest's embrace. However, the boys' mischievous attempt to conjure Andie's spirit through a prank game falls flat, leaving Pip distressed. In the hush of the night, Pip, Cara, and Lauren venture out from their tent, seeking solace in the wilderness, their conversation turning to Cara's burgeoning feelings for Ruby, a girl who has stolen her heart.

Pip's heart sank as she realized Cara had disclosed Ruby's secret to Lauren before her, yet somehow, they managed to regroup and make their way back to the tent. Along the dimly lit path, their attention was drawn to a mysterious figure strolling with a flickering torch, piquing Pip's curiosity. In a spur of the moment, she chased after him, only to stumble and become entangled in the depths of the forest, her calls for help echoing through the night until Cara's reassuring voice guided her back to safety.

Once inside the tent, the boys vowed to stand guard outside, their shadows cast against the canvas as a silent pledge of protection. As Pip settled in, her fingers brushed against a chilling discovery hidden beneath her pillow—a note, its words stark and ominous: "Stop Digging Pippa." The message sent shivers down her spine, yet she kept it to herself, fearing the ripple effects it might unleash.

Dawn broke, bringing with it a new day and Cara's earnest reassurance that despite the recent misstep, their bond remained unshaken, stronger than ever, promising Pip that their friendship would weather any storm. As Cara departed for home, Pip's gaze lingered on an unexpected sight: Max and Emma, their voices hushed yet intense, locked in conversation within the confines of his car. The encounter sparked fresh doubts in Pip's mind, and she mentally added the enigmatic Da Silva siblings to the growing list of suspects, each name whispered in the confines of her troubled thoughts.

On that fateful day, Ravi made his appearance at Pip's abode, and the duo delved deep into the murder investigation board, their eyes scanning every detail intently. Ravi's conversation with Pip revolved around Dan, their minds swirling with speculations whether he was indeed the enigmatic older figure Andie had been secretly entwined with.

To uncover more clues, they delved into Andie's social media accounts, a digital trail that revealed a tumultuous rift between Nat, Andie, and Emma, triggered by the leak of Andie's intimate photographs. Pip's imagination raced as he pondered the possibility that Nat, enraged by the betrayal, might have silenced Andie forever. He envisioned Nat, posing as Emma, sending a chilling invitation to hang out, all the while harboring dark intentions.

As the night cloaked the sky, Pip and Ravi confronted Nat, their voices hushed yet urgent as they probed into the intricacies of Andie's life. Nat's revelation that Andie had grown distant and secretive with her and Emma only fueled their suspicions further. A new name emerged in the conversation—Max Hastings, leaving Pip to question whether this was the mysterious older man who had captured Andie's heart.

With the night deepening, Ravi retreated to the comfort of his own home, while Pip, driven by a relentless urge to uncover the truth, embarked on a solitary journey to the Hastings' residence. The air around him crackled with anticipation, each step bringing him closer to unraveling the mystery that had shrouded Andie's untimely demise.

Pip inquires of Max, with a hint of intrigue, if he was privy to the reason behind Andie and Ravi's heated dispute in 2019, prior to Andie's mysterious disappearance. Max divulges that Sal had uncovered Andie's secret life as an accomplice to a drug peddler, revealing that he himself had been one of her clients. He further elaborates that Sal's aversion to narcotics fueled his desire for Andie to abandon her illicit endeavors.

Pip's curiosity piqued, she ponders over the whereabouts of this shadowy drug lord, Andie's former employer. As the episode draws to a close, a glimmer of a lead emerges – whispers of a notorious "calamity" party held in the high school halls, where perhaps more truths about Andie's past lie waiting to be uncovered. And so, with renewed vigor, Pip's quest for answers unfolds, setting the stage for a more gripping narrative ahead.
